Comments

Crises has always felt to me like a sequel to Five Miles Out. Like the previous album it uses the formula of a long instrumental first half and a series of smaller tracks for the second half. The title track is the kind of ambling, morphing instrumental I've come to expect from Mike, changing direction at the drop of a tubular bell.

"Moonlight Shadow" was a huge hit at the time for Mike, and it's likely if you've heard any of his songs, you'll have heard that one. It's also the best of the shorter tracks. "Foreign Affair" I find annoyingly repetative, but "Shadow on the Wall" is another classic, and the others are fine. What mysterious link does the "Taurus" series have and is there a "Taurus 4"?
